The Advanced Fuel System that Powers Modern Diesel Engines

Common rail engines are different from traditional diesel engines. Rather than injecting fuel directly into each cylinder, the fuel is stored in a reservoir called a “common rail.” This common rail functions like a large container that stores pressurized fuel and delivers it to each cylinder at the time it is required. It allows the engine to control how much fuel it receives more precisely, so that it can run more efficiently and with more power.

There are numerous reasons why the common rail diesel engine is very significant in terms of the future of diesel power. One of the biggest reasons is it creates better fuel economy. So with the right amount of fuel being injected in the cylinder, the engine would require lesser fuel for maximum power output. This is good for the driver and the environment.
